sEst: Accurate Sex-Estimation and Abnormality Detection in Methylation Microarray Data.

Chol-Hee Jung1, Daniel J Park2, Peter Georgeson3,4

  • 1Melbourne Bioinformatics, The University of Melbourne, Parkville, VIC 3010, Australia. jungch@unimelb.edu.au.

International Journal of Molecular Sciences
|October 18, 2018
PubMed
Summary
This summary is machine-generated.

This study introduces sEst, a software tool for analyzing DNA methylation data. It accurately determines biological sex and identifies sex chromosome abnormalities, improving data quality for disease research.

Area of Science:

  • Genomics
  • Epigenetics
  • Bioinformatics

Background:

  • DNA methylation is crucial in disease development and prognosis, but influenced by biological sex.
  • Accurate sex assignment and detection of sex chromosome abnormalities are vital for DNA methylation study quality control.
  • Sex-specific methylation patterns arise from sex chromosome number differences and X-chromosome inactivation.

Purpose of the Study:

  • To develop and validate a software tool, sEst, for inferring sex and detecting sex chromosome abnormalities from DNA methylation microarray data.
  • To enhance the quality control of DNA methylation datasets by identifying mislabelled or chromosomally abnormal samples.

Main Methods:

  • Utilized clustering analysis within the sEst software.
  • Applied sEst to analyze DNA methylation microarray data from publicly available datasets.

Main Results:

  • sEst accurately inferred the biological sex of samples.
  • The tool successfully identified mislabelled samples.
  • sEst detected sex chromosome abnormalities, including Klinefelter and Turner syndromes, a capability lacking in existing methods.

Conclusions:

  • sEst is a valuable tool for improving the quality control of DNA methylation studies.
  • Accurate sex and sex chromosome abnormality detection by sEst can significantly impact disease research utilizing microarray data.
